feat(context): add dsh executor and headroom active loopback probe
Wire DeepSeek Harness as an optional fourth code executor (default off) and add a loopback observation script that compares prompt tokens through headroom proxy with OPENAI_TARGET_API_URL pointed at the compat proxy. Co-authored-by: Cursor <cursoragent@cursor.com>
